Well ATM particularly stands for asynchronous transfer mode and may be described as a standard cell based switching strategy which expressly makes the use of asynchronous time division multiplexing which enables transforming certain data into specific sized cells or cell relay and gives distinct data link layer services that particularly run on OSI Layer 1 physical links. Most often individuals mistake it with packet switched networks like the Internet Protocol or Ethernet where varying sized small-scale packets are used for data transfer.
ATM or asynchronous transfer mode generally possesses elements of two forms of networking. This means that it can be used in both circuit switched in addition to packet switched networking. This permits it to operate as the best solution to a wide range of data transfer. It is also quite suitable for real time media transport. The design which is mainly utilized in this particular method of data transfer is primarily connection oriented, thus easily linking the two end points with virtual circuit even before the data starting to transmit.
